How they compare

Antigua and Barbuda currently reports 35,170 kg against 23,554 kg in Saint Vincent and the Grenadines, a difference of 11,616 kg.

That makes Antigua and Barbuda's figure about 1.5 times Saint Vincent and the Grenadines's.

The two have swapped places 7 times across 63 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Saint Vincent and the Grenadines ahead.

Antigua and Barbuda ranks 179th and Saint Vincent and the Grenadines ranks 180th of 190 countries.

Across the 7 decades both report, Antigua and Barbuda averaged higher in 6 and Saint Vincent and the Grenadines in 1.

The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
